Domestic Procurement Coordinator
Location: Newark, Delaware
Reports To: Order & Inside sales Supervisor, Product Manager, CEO, works alongside international purchasing coordinator, and logistic coordinator/warehouse manager.
Job Summary
The domestic procurement coordinator is responsible for overseeing and coordinating the procurement of lighting components, services, and finished goods from the U.S. -based vendors and the LCL freight service provider. This role ensures timely, cost-effective, and high-quality sources of materials while maintaining strong relationships with suppliers and internal stakeholders. This position manages purchasing activities, vendor communication, order tracking, and issue resolution.
Job Duties
Purchase Order Management
- Create, track, and manage purchase orders with U.S. suppliers for components, service, raw materials, and finished lighting products.
- Monitor and track open orders to ensure on-time delivery; proactively follow up with vendors on shipping status.
- Ensure accuracy of order details including pricing, lead times, and delivery terms.
- Follow up on open orders and proactively resolve delays or discrepancies.
- Build and maintain strong working relationships with domestic suppliers.
- Coordinate with logistic team to build and maintain strong business relationships with the domestic LCL freight service provider
- Negotiate pricing, terms, and delivery schedules to ensure best value.
- Monitor vendor performance and address issues related to quality, timeliness, or compliance and suggest improvements where needed.
- Inventory Coordination
- Work closely with inventory and warehouse teams to align procurement with inventory levels and sales forecasts.
- Help prevent stockouts or overstock situations through timely replenishment planning.
- Data & Systems Management
- Maintain accurate procurement records, supplier documentation, and dates in the company system.
- Run reports to support purchasing decisions and internal communication. Support audits and record-keeping for all procurement transactions.
- Cross-Functional Collaboration
- Coordinate with product development, logistics, accounting, and sales teams to ensure alignment on product availability and timelines.
- Coordinate with finance and accounts payable on invoice approvals and vendor payments.
